/*
 * Prefetcher constants for the Larkspur map-tile pipeline.
 * These values were retuned after the Quillbrook release caused
 * aggressive prefetching to saturate the edge caches in the
 * Tarnmoor region during peak commute hours. The radius, queue
 * depth, and backoff figures below were validated against two
 * weeks of replayed traffic, and the release manager should not
 * bump them without rerunning that replay. The current approved
 * tuning constants are as follows.
 */

constants for fajop-tahaf:
RATE_LIMITS = {
    "holael": 2,
    "oliael": 10,
    "druael": 10,
    "wenwyn": 10,
}

## Runbook: Snapshot Test Failures — Glimmerkit UI

If the nightly snapshot suite for Glimmerkit fails, first check whether the theme token build ran before the test stage; stale tokens cause mass diffs. Do not bulk-approve snapshots during an incident. Re-run the suite once with a clean cache. The test runner uses the configuration below.

deployment values, kajep-kageg:
[praix]
host = praix.paliqcorp.corp
user = praix_svc
database = praix_prod

From the outgoing Director of Product to the incoming Director of Operations, copied to finance. The Larkspur range will be withdrawn over eighteen months: last orders in Q2, final shipments by year-end following. Spares commitments run a further three years, and finance should carry a provision for warranty tails and component write-downs. Key supplier exit terms are already negotiated with Tovren Components. Commercial sensitivities around the replacement roadmap are summarised in the confidential note below.

management briefing: Project Ulavan slips by two quarters because of the staffing delay.

Visitor Policy — First-Aid Room

The first-aid room at Calloway Wharf is on the ground floor beside the main stairwell and is available to staff and visitors alike. If a visitor needs attention, escort them there and notify a trained first-aider via reception — do not leave the visitor unattended. The room is kept locked to protect supplies and privacy. New starters are expected to know how to open it in an emergency. The door operates on a keypad, and the code is given below.

staff pass of kawip-hawef = bdg-QLP-2